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Programming Course Catalog
- Status: Free Trial
Skills you'll gain: Jest (JavaScript Testing Framework), User Acceptance Testing (UAT), Cucumber (Software), Postman API Platform, Software Testing, Behavior-Driven Development, Test Tools, Selenium (Software), Test Driven Development (TDD), Unit Testing, Acceptance Testing, Performance Testing, Functional Testing, Test Automation, Usability Testing, Application Programming Interface (API), User Interface (UI), Test Case, API Design, Javascript
- Status: Free Trial
Skills you'll gain: ASP.NET, Restful API, Object-Relational Mapping, Web Applications, User Accounts, Data Integrity, Single Sign-On (SSO), Application Programming Interface (API), Authentications, Back-End Web Development, Performance Tuning, Authorization (Computing), Data Management, Model View Controller, Application Security, Multi-Factor Authentication, Data Security
- Status: Free Trial
Coursera Instructor Network
Skills you'll gain: Prompt Engineering, LLM Application, Responsible AI, Application Deployment, Application Development, Large Language Modeling, Artificial Intelligence, Generative AI, Open Source Technology, Application Security, Continuous Monitoring
- Status: Preview
Scrimba
Skills you'll gain: UI Components, JavaScript Frameworks, Web Frameworks, Event-Driven Programming, Data Import/Export, Web Applications, Front-End Web Development, Javascript, Web Development
Coursera Project Network
Skills you'll gain: JSON, Application Programming Interface (API), Application Development, Data Access, Restful API, Python Programming, User Interface (UI)
- Status: Free Trial
Skills you'll gain: Load Balancing, Scalability, Microservices, .NET Framework, Redis, Application Performance Management, Cloud Computing Architecture, Cloud Applications, Databases, System Monitoring, Cloud Infrastructure, Software Architecture, Distributed Computing, C# (Programming Language), Microsoft Azure, Performance Tuning
- Status: Preview
Skills you'll gain: Cloud Security, Internet Of Things, Network Security, Application Security, Security Engineering, Information Systems Security, Data Security, Cloud Services, Infrastructure Security, Security Controls, Cloud Computing, Application Design, Time Series Analysis and Forecasting, Encryption, Cryptography, Data Analysis, Identity and Access Management, Data Integrity, Authentications, Predictive Analytics
- Status: Free Trial
Universidad Nacional Autónoma de México
Skills you'll gain: Creativity, Generative AI, Artificial Intelligence, Computational Thinking, Computer Programming, Visualization (Computer Graphics), Algorithms, Musical Composition, Art History, Music History
Coursera Project Network
Skills you'll gain: Data Structures, Network Routing, Computer Networking, Object Oriented Programming (OOP), Python Programming, Network Routers, Program Development, Algorithms, Computer Programming
Coursera Project Network
Skills you'll gain: IntelliJ IDEA, Software Development Tools, Development Environment, Scala Programming, Build Tools, Software Development, Software Installation, Software Engineering
- Status: Free
Coursera Project Network
Skills you'll gain: Shiny (R Package), Data Visualization, Interactive Data Visualization, Dashboard, Data Visualization Software, R Programming, Data Wrangling, User Interface (UI) Design, Ggplot2, Data Manipulation, Data Integration, Data Import/Export
Skills you'll gain: Distributed Computing, Java, Middleware, NoSQL, Event-Driven Programming, Databases, Software Architecture, Servers, Web Services, Microservices, Scalability, Communication Systems
Programming learners also search
In summary, here are 10 of our most popular programming courses
- Software Testing for Developers: Codio
- Web Application Development with ASP.NET Core: EDUCBA
- Building Production-Ready Apps with Large Language Models: Coursera Instructor Network
- Learn Svelte: Scrimba
- Storing, Retrieving, and Processing JSON data with Python: Coursera Project Network
- Building Scalable Applications with .NET Core: EDUCBA
- Developing Secure IoT Applications: EDUCBA
- Creatividad computacional: Universidad Nacional Autónoma de México
- Determine Shortest Paths Between Routers Using Python: Coursera Project Network
- Configuring for Scala with IntelliJ IDEA: Coursera Project Network